Frequently asked questions about campings in Sheffield

  • What are the best activities for camping lovers in Sheffield ?

    Sheffield's got loads to offer campers! You can go hiking in the Peak District, explore the city's parks, or even try your hand at rock climbing at Stanage Edge. For something different, check out the Sheffield Botanical Gardens or the Millennium Gallery.

  • Why is Sheffield an ideal place for camping?

    Sheffield is a great base for camping because it's close to the Peak District National Park, with its stunning scenery and endless walking trails. Plus, the city itself has loads to offer, from museums and galleries to pubs and restaurants.

  • What outdoor events or nature festivals are happening in and around Sheffield?

    There are plenty of events happening in Sheffield throughout the year. The Tramlines Festival is a big music event in July, and the Sheffield Food Festival happens in September. For nature lovers, the Peak District National Park has events like the Dark Peak Walking Festival and the Kinder Scout Challenge.
